At the time of writing, the following accessories were available for the D5200.

Power

• Rechargeable Li-ion Battery EN-EL14(0 14): Additional EN-EL14 batteries are available from local retailers and Nikon-authorized service representatives.

• Battery Charger MH-24(0 14): Recharge EN-EL14 batteries.

• Power Connector EP-5A, AC Adapter EH-5b: These accessories can be used to power

the camera for extended periods (EH-5a and EH-5 AC adapters can also be used). A power connector EP-5A is required to connect the camera to the EH-5b, EH-5a, or EH-5; see page 212 for details.

Filters

Filters intended for special-effects photography may interfere with autofocus or the electronic rangefinder.

The D5200 can not be used with linear polarizing filters. Use C-PL or C-PL II circular polarizing filters instead.

NC filters are recommended for protecting the lens.

To prevent ghosting, use of a filter is not recommended when the subject is framed against a bright light, or when a bright light source is in the frame.

Center-weighted metering is recommended with filters with exposure factors (filter factors) over 1 × (Y44, Y48, Y52, O56, R60, X0, X1, C-PL, ND2S, ND4, ND4S, ND8, ND8S, ND400, A2, A12, B2, B8, B12). See the filter manual for details.

DK-20C Eyepiece Correction Lenses: Lenses are available with diopters of –5, –4, –3, –2, 0, +0.5, +1, +2, and +3 m–1when the camera diopter adjustment control is in the neutral position (–1 m–1). Use eyepiece correction lenses only if the desired focus can not be achieved with the built in diopter adjustment control (–1.7 to +0.7 m–1). Test eyepiece correction lenses before purchase to ensure that the desired focus can be achieved. The rubber eyecup can not be used

eyepiece • Magnifier DG-2: The DG-2 magnifies the scene displayed in the center of the

accessories viewfinder for greater precision during focusing. Eyepiece adapter required (available separately).

Eyepiece Adapter DK-22: The DK-22 is used when attaching the DG-2 magnifier.

Right-Angle Viewing Attachment DR-6: The DR-6 attaches at a right angle to the viewfinder eyepiece, allowing the image in the viewfinder to be viewed at right angles to the lens (for example, from directly above when the camera is horizontal).

Capture NX 2: A complete photo editing package offering such features as white balance adjustment and color control points.

Camera Control Pro 2: Control the camera remotely from a computer to record movies and photographs and save photographs directly to the computer hard

Note: Use the latest versions of Nikon software. Most Nikon software offers an auto update feature when the computer is connected to the Internet. See the websites listed on page xv for the latest information on supported operating systems.

Body Cap BF-1B/Body Cap BF-1A: The body cap keeps the mirror, viewfinder screen, and low-pass filter free of dust when a lens is not in place.
